HARRIS, J.
Because appellant’s petition for certiora-ri was untimely filed, we are without jurisdiction and therefore dismiss the petition. This dismissal, however, is without prejudice to seek relief below based on the problems allegedly encountered in receiving a copy of the order. See Conklin v. Moore, 739 So.2d 714 (Fla. 1st DCA 1999).
PETITION FOR CERTIORARI DISMISSED.
SAWAYA and ORFINGER, R.B., JJ., concur.
